Lead Acid Battery: Definition, Types, Charging Methods, and How

The lead-acid battery, invented by Gaston Planté in 1859, is the first rechargeable battery. It generates energy through chemical reactions between lead and sulfuric acid. Despite its lower energy density compared to newer batteries, it remains popular for automotive and backup power due to its reliability. How to Store a Lead-Acid Battery

A lead-acid battery can be stored for up to two years. However, it is important to note that all batteries gradually self-discharge over time, which is known as ''calendar fade.'' Therefore, it is essential to check the voltage and/or specific gravity of the battery and apply a charge when the battery falls to 70 percent state-of-charge, which reflects 2.07V/cell open

Lead–Acid Batteries

Lead–acid batteries are comprised of a lead-dioxide cathode, a sponge metallic lead anode, and a sulfuric acid solution electrolyte. The widespread applications of lead–acid batteries include, among others, the traction, starting, lighting, and ignition in vehicles, called SLI batteries and stationary batteries for uninterruptable power supplies and PV systems.

Energy Storage with Lead–Acid Batteries

The fundamental elements of the lead–acid battery were set in place over 150 years ago 1859, Gaston Planté was the first to report that a useful discharge current could be drawn from a pair of lead plates that had been immersed in sulfuric acid and subjected to a charging current, see Figure 13.1.Later, Camille Fauré proposed the concept of the pasted plate.

Lead batteries for utility energy storage: A review

A large battery system was commissioned in Aachen in Germany in 2016 as a pilot plant to evaluate various battery technologies for energy storage applications. This has five different battery types, two lead–acid batteries and three Li-ion batteries and the intention is to compare their operation under similar conditions.

Lead Acid Battery Lifespan: How Long They Last And

Sealed lead acid batteries usually last 3 to 12 years. Their lifespan is affected by factors like temperature, usage conditions, and maintenance. To extend Regular exposure to temperatures above 40°C can result in a lifespan of only a few years, compared to a typical lifespan of 5 to 7 years under optimal conditions.

How many small lead acid batteries are produced a year?

The WasteCare Group, operators of the BatteryBack battery compliance scheme, estimates that at least 15,000 tonnes of small lead acid batteries weighing less than 4kg are placed on the market each year. The company says that only 1,500 tonnes are declared by producers.

Where are lead batteries recycled?

In developing countries spent lead batteries are recycled both in industrial facilities and by informal small enterprises. Industrial recycling smelters use both the grid metal and the lead-containing paste to produce secondary lead.
